About the plane: The Polikarpov I-16 was a Soviet fighter aircraft of revolutionary design, it was the world's first low-wing cantilever monoplane fighter with retractable landing gear to attain operational status and as such 'introduced a new vogue in fighter design', introduced in the mid-1930s.
About the kit: Kit has surface detail, separate trailing edge flaps, detailed cockpit and fuselage area, transparent (instrument panel, landing lights and windscreen), detailed radial engine with face plate and optional cowling, ShKAS machine guns, single piece propeller with separate spinner, detailed wheel wells and optional undercarriage.
